    Description

    BAPTA tetrapotassium is a selective and cell-impermeant chelator for calcium. BAPTA has high selectivity against magnesium and calcium. BAPTA tetrapotassium can also inhibit phospholipase C activity independently of their role as Ca2+ chelators[1][2][3].

    In Vitro

    BAPTA tetrapotassium is widely used as an intracellular buffer to investigate the effects caused by Ca2+ release from intracellular calcium stores or Ca2+ influx via Ca2+-permeable channels in the plasma membrane[1].
    BAPTA tetrapotassium can be introduced into cells via methods such as patch-clamp and microinjection[1].
    BAPTA tetrapotassium inhibits PLC activity in isolated Drosophila melanogaster photoreceptor cells with an IC50 of approximately 8 mM[2].
